Nick Cave NEW NOVEL "The Death of Bunny Munro"

AT LONG LAST, Nick Cave is about to release his LONG awaited follow up to his debut book And the Ass saw the Angel which saw Euchrid Euchrow descend into madness in the fictional deep south town of Ukulore Valley. The lead singer of The Birthday Party, The Bad Seeds and Grinderman, Cave has been performing music for more than 30 years. He has collaborated with Kylie Minogue, PJ Harvey and many others. His debut novel And the Ass Saw the Angel was published in 1989.

Born in Australia, Cave now lives in Brighton.
